Definition of «independent publishing»

Independent publishing refers to the process of producing, marketing and distributing a book or other written material without the involvement of traditional publishers. This means that authors take on all aspects of bringing their work to market themselves, including editing, design, printing, and promotion. Independent publishing has become increasingly popular in recent years due to advances in technology and changes in the publishing industry. It allows writers to have more control over their work, retaining rights and profits while bypassing traditional gatekeepers such as agents or publishers.
